Tony is a very simple person who loves life, loves family, and works hard for the family. He is not a good provider, but a good husband and father who works hard. Of course, he also has his own shortcomings, impulsiveness, not accepting grievances, and prejudice at the beginning - the phenomenon and psychology unique to that era. So, the first two cups show that Tony took the job with prejudice and unwillingness, and as I said, he is a provider. Also, he is a reliable partner.
Dr. Shelley, on the other hand, was holding his frame from the very beginning. When I first walked into the Doctor's house with Tony, everyone was probably like me. It wasn't like an artist's or a Doctor's residence. It was vulgar, crowded, and not too fancy. Later we learned that this is the manifestation of the doctor's mental confusion, just as he shouted to Tony in the heavy rain: "If I'm not white enough, if I'm not black enough, if I'm not man enough, then tell me, Tony, who I am ?" So someone who was at a loss in real life found Tony, made him his driver, and set out on his own journey through the Midwest—with his own upbringing, dignity, courage, and a unique ability to tolerate and change The determination of the whole world.
When did Tony change his prejudice? After hearing Dr. Shelley play the piano for the first time, Tony wrote to his beloved wife that night, praising Dr. as a genius, a man of many ideas and thoughts. Yes, Tony didn't miss it. And we, like Tony, were conquered by the Doctor. Dr. Shelley is indeed a genius, an artist, and a black artist who deserves respect and applause. So the next Tony really started to serve the doctor, from the Steinway piano to the swimming pool, from the fried chicken to the toilet, and finally with the doctor to find happiness and self under the surrounded and stared by black people, Tony heard from that window After Dr.'s music, he truly recognized that Dr. was "virtuoso", began to think for him sincerely, gradually entered his heart, and began to become friends with him.

Shirley, on the other hand, was noble, well-bred, educated, and qualified. He was an aristocratic figure in both thought and behavior. But in a special period, he is a person who has no sense of belonging and security, and a person who does not have much real life experience. So, at first, his arrogance and contempt for Tony was simply impossible to hide. Since when did you start to take off your defenses and gradually approach Tony's? In this way, people who seem to be irrelevant come to a planned trip. In the last Birmingham performance, I was stunned when Tony persuaded the Doctor to hold back and not care about it. Later, I was shocked when the Doctor tried his best to stand up for himself. When I watched it for the second time, I understood that it was two people influencing each other. So later friendship is a matter of course. In the final impromptu performance, the doctor removed his disguise and gradually found himself, and Tony also got his own joy in it.
Two places made me laugh. "KFC fried chicken, in Kenya! Best fried chicken I've ever had!" "Dr, Pittsburgh really disappointed me! (You know!)"
In the end, the conversation between the doctor and Dolores was very meaningful: "Thank you for sharing husband with me!" "Thank you for helping him with the letters!" It turns out that we all understand.
This is not a love story, but it can bring us a lot of warmth. May there be more of this kind of warmth and more of this kind of movies in this world.
I understand the fusion of the two as a reconciliation of pride and prejudice. But Darcy's arrogance and Elizabeth's prejudice are obvious, while Tony and the Doctor have both pride and prejudice, and then the pride and prejudice are gone.
